
Justin Bieber Concert Canceled After Fans Trampled
By PopEater Staff Posted Apr 26th 2010 10:29AM
Pop sensation Justin Bieber was forced to cancel his massive, outdoor performance in front of the Overseas Passenger Terminal at Circular Quay in Sydney, Australia, when several young fans were trampled after at least ten girls fainted. Over 5,000 people camped out overnight for the performance, but police were forced to cancel the outdoor show after paramedics had to break the barriers and rescue the young girls from being crushed by the massive crowd, New Zealand Herald reports.


Police later said all of the girls were treated at the scene for minor injuries.
Bieber was meant to sing three songs at a free gig for the 'Sunrise' morning program; however, "mass scenes of hysteria" erupted outside the studio. "I am just as disappointed as everyone else with the news from this morning. I want to sing for my fans," Bieber tweeted.
"I'm so sorry it got out of control. We want what's best for the fans and don't want anybody to get hurt," Bieber added during the 'Sunrise' show. Watch the live footage:
This incident is not the first time Bieber has caused riots. In November, a crowd of nearly 3,000 screaming kids and parents at a Long Island, New York, mall started to get rowdy. Five people were taken to hospitals with minor injuries and police arrested Bieber's manager.
At the time, police asked Bieber's manager, Scott "Scooter" Braun, to alert fans via Twitter that the event was going to have to be canceled, but prosecutors say it took Braun an hour and a half to send two tweets. Ultimately, it lead to charges being filed against Braun. His lawyer asserts it took just seven minutes to get the word out. [Asking yourself, "Who the heck is Justin Bieber?"
